The main objective was to study the technical feasibility of applying the residue generated by the second-generation ethanol obtained from sugarcane to partially replace the cement in concrete mixtures. The residue has lignin in its composition and was applied without further industrial processing. In addition, the research sought to obtain answers regarding the performance of these compositions in relation to the workability in the fresh state and the compressive strength and durability in the hardened state and compared the possible behavior differences between the residues with and without the presence of superplasticizer and plasticizers, both chemical admixtures. The results showed that there was compatibility between the residues and chemical admixtures; the setting time and the consistency index increased with the application of the residues; the compressive strength with residues was lower than the reference composition, but still demonstrated feasibility; in all the tests carried out the durability improved in the residue compositions. The Centre for Territory, Environment and Construction (CTAC) is a research unit of the School of Engineering of University of Minho (UMinho), recognised by the “FCT – Fundação para a Ciência e Tecnologia” (Foundation for Science and Technology), associated to the Department of Civil Engineering (DEC), with whom it shares resources and namely human resources.
Currently CTAC aggregates 25 researchers holding a PhD of which 20 are faculty professors of the Civil Engineering Department. Read more
